UCC and Disciples leaders offer solidarity and encourage study of the Kairos Palestine II document, “A Moment of Truth: Faith in a Time of Genocide”
Christian Church (Disciples of Christ) and United Church of Christ General Ministers and Presidents, Rev. Terri Hord Owens and Rev. Dr. Karen Georgia Thompson, and Global Ministries Co-Executives, Rev. Dr. LaMarco Cable and Rev. Shari Prestemon, issued an Advent letter following the issuance of the recently-released “A Moment of Truth: Faith in a Time of Genocide” document by Kairos Palestine. “Faith in a Time of Genocide” is the second major letter issued by Kairos Palestine, the first having been released in December 2009.
The Disciples and UCC leaders’ letter points to the urgency of “the context of the especially devastating catastrophe of genocide,” and states, “As we receive this new call from our Palestinian Christian siblings, we likewise urge you to read it carefully and reflect on how you can take action.”
The letter closes by quoting the Kairos Palestine II document, “From the heart of pain, genocide and displacement, we raise this cry, a prophetic cry of steadfastness,” responding by stating, “May we continue to walk in solidarity with our partners so that a peace with justice may prevail in the land of Jesus’ birth and ministry.”
